    50 mg Ubiquinol

    CoQ10 in its potent antioxidant form that is more difficult for the body to generate as we age and for individuals with certain health conditions.

    Two beneficial forms of CoQ10, ubiquinone, and ubiquinol, are continually recycled in the body. Ubiquinol acts as a powerful antioxidant in mitochondria and lipid membranes. Sufficient amounts of both forms are needed for efficient ATP production. Normally, ubiquinone is efficiently reduced to ubiquinol during absorption or shortly after entering the bloodstream. However, this ability declines with age and may be compromised in certain individuals. As ubiquinol can be directly utilized by the body, CoQH™ is a good alternative for those who may have difficulty converting ubiquinone to ubiquinol. Pure ubiquinol is solubilized in d-limonene oil and stabilized with natural emulsifying agents.

    There are two forms of Co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10), ubiquinone and ubiquinol, which are continually recycled in the body from one form to the other. While both forms are needed for energy production, ubiquinol is the most common form and can be directly utilized by the body. In addition to advancing age, poor diet, illness, and certain medications can impair the body’s ability to produce CoQ10. Klaire Labs’ CoQH provides CoQ10 in a reduced ubiquinol form.

    Background

    CoQ10 is a unique compound that is essential for health on the cellular and systems level. Inside every cell, CoQ10 acts as an important cofactor inside the mitochondria, the “engine” of the cell. With the support of CoQ10, the mitochondria create energy to fuel cellular function and health. In addition, CoQ10 acts as an antioxidant, protecting tissues from free radicals and research has demonstrated the supportive role this compound plays in cardiovascular and neurologic health.
